Abstract
A system, apparatus, graphical user interface and methods are provided for conducting electronic voice communications with status notifications. A user of a first portable device executing a communication application selects a multi-function control that automatically initiates an audio recording, which is automatically sent toward another participant of an active communication session when the control is released. The same multi-function control may be used to transmit a textual message. A representation of the recording is displayed on the user'"'"'s device, with an indicator that changes appearance when the other participant plays the recording. In addition, when one user initiates an audio recording that will be automatically sent to another user, the other user'"'"'s device is advised of the initiation of recording and displays that status for the other user.

29. A method of operating a portable device having a touch-screen display and a microphone, the method comprising:
-
displaying a conversation region on the touch-screen display, the conversation region being populated with communications between an operator of the portable device and an operator of another device as the communications occur; displaying a text entry window on the touch-screen display; displaying a selectable control on the touch-screen display; and upon selection of the selectable control; if the control is selected for a predetermined duration of time; commencing recording of audio with the microphone; and transmitting the audio recording toward the other device upon de-selection of the control; and if the control is selected for less than the predetermined duration of time, transmitting a textual message previously composed in the text entry window toward the other device.
